A Limited Liability Company or LLC is a cross between a corporation
and partnership. It basically combines
the protections of a corporation and the flexibility of a partnership. For one,
members of this kind of company are not liable for debts and they are able to
file an informal tax return.

Answer:
the final amount is = $280.51
Step-by-step explanation:
The standard formula for compound interest is given as;
A = P(1+r/n)^(nt) .....1
Given that;
Principal P = $200
Interest rate r = 7% = 0.07
Time t = 5 years
Final amount = A
Number of time compounded per year n = 1
Substituting the values;
A = 200(1+0.07/1)^(1×5)
A = 280.51
Therefore, the final amount is = $280.51
